History of the Breed
Yorkshire Terriers were originally bred by workers in the textile market to manage rat populations. A number of breeds added to the advancement of the Yorkie, including the Skye Terrier, Manchester Terrier, and the Dandie Dinmont Terrier. By the late 1800s, Yorkies had gotten appeal as companion family pets, leading to the facility of type standards and official recognition by kennel clubs.
Attributes of Yorkies
Yorkies have several defining qualities that make them special. Below is a table summarizing their key qualities:
CharacteristicDescriptionSizeToy breed; normally weighs in between 4-7 lbsHeight8-9 inches tall at the shoulderCoatLong, silky hair; needs regular groomingColorMainly blue and tanLifespan12-15 yearsTemperamentEnergetic, caring, smartPhysical Traits
Yorkies are small with a stylish stature. Their long, streaming coats require regular grooming, and their hallmark colors of blue and tan contribute to their visual appeal.
Temperament
Yorkies are understood for their lively nature and caring temperament. They are spirited, positive, and frequently display a personality bigger than their size. In spite of their small stature, Yorkies can be quite vibrant and protective of their owners.

Grooming
Grooming is one of the most important aspects of Yorkie care due to their long hair. Here are some grooming suggestions:
Grooming TaskFrequencyBathingEvery 4-6 weeksBrushing3-4 times a weekNail cuttingEvery 3-4 weeksEar cleaningMonthlyNutrition

Workout
In spite of their small size, Yorkies require routine workout to stay healthy and pleased. A combination of short walks and playtime is generally appropriate. Below is a recommended workout regimen:
ActivityDurationStrolls20-30 minutes dailyPlaytime15-30 minutes dailyHealth Considerations
Like all types, Yorkies are vulnerable to certain health conditions. Some typical health problems include:
Dental Problems: Yorkies are vulnerable to oral illness; regular dental check-ups and cleaning are important.Patellar Luxation: A common joint issue where the kneecap dislocates.Tracheal Collapse: A condition that affects the trachea, resulting in breathing difficulties.
Routine veterinary check-ups can assist determine and handle these conditions.
Yorkie Training Tips
Training a Yorkshire Terrier can be both fulfilling and difficult. Here are some reliable training pointers:
Start Early: Begin training as a puppy to establish great habits.Use Positive Reinforcement: Reward etiquette with deals with or appreciation.Keep Sessions Short: Limit training sessions to 5-10 minutes to maintain their attention.Socialization: Introduce your Yorkie to different environments, individuals, and other animals.Frequently asked questions about Yorkies
